According to the <strong>National Hurricane Center (NHC)<\/strong>, this is the <strong>first tropical disturbance<\/strong> under surveillance this season and, despite its <strong>low probability of development<\/strong>, it&#8217;s garnering attention due to its location and potential evolution.<\/p>\n<p>&nbsp;<\/p>\n<p><strong>Limited risk for Florida but gusty winds expected<\/strong><\/p>\n<p>While this <strong>offshore system<\/strong> currently shows only a <strong>10% chance<\/strong> of developing into a <strong>subtropical or tropical cyclone<\/strong> over the next seven days, the <strong>Florida peninsula<\/strong>, especially from <strong>Jacksonville to the Space Coast<\/strong>, might still <strong>experience effects<\/strong>. Forecasts suggest <strong>gusty onshore winds<\/strong> between <strong>25 and 35 mph<\/strong>, along with <strong>rough surf conditions<\/strong> and an <strong>increased risk of thunderstorms<\/strong> beginning <strong>Thursday<\/strong> and continuing into <strong>Friday<\/strong>.<\/p>\n<p>The disturbance is projected to <strong>move northeastward<\/strong> at a speed between <strong>10 and 15 mph<\/strong>, staying <strong>offshore<\/strong> and gradually drifting away from <strong>Florida<\/strong>, reducing the threat of direct landfall or significant tropical development. Meteorologist <strong>Noah Bergren<\/strong> from <strong>FOX 35 Storm Team<\/strong> notes that, in the best-case scenario, the system might briefly reach <strong>depression status<\/strong>, but it is <strong>unlikely<\/strong> to become a <strong>tropical storm<\/strong>.<\/p>\n<p>&nbsp;<\/p>\n<p><strong>Above-average hurricane season forecasted for 2025<\/strong><\/p>\n<p>This early-season disturbance comes amid <strong>heightened expectations<\/strong> for a <strong>busier-than-usual Atlantic hurricane season<\/strong>. The <strong>official outlook<\/strong> from both <strong>NOAA<\/strong> and <strong>Colorado State University (CSU)<\/strong> forecasts an <strong>above-average number of storms<\/strong>, driven by <strong>warmer ocean temperatures<\/strong> and a <strong>neutral ENSO phase<\/strong> which typically results in <strong>reduced wind shear<\/strong> across the <strong>Atlantic Basin<\/strong>.<\/p>\n<p><strong>NOAA&#8217;s forecast includes<\/strong>:<br \/>\n<strong>13 to 19 named storms<\/strong>,<br \/>\n<strong>6 to 10 hurricanes<\/strong>,<br \/>\n<strong>3 to 5 major hurricanes<\/strong> (Category 3 or higher).<\/p>\n<p><strong>CSU anticipates<\/strong>:<br \/>\n<strong>17 named storms<\/strong>,<br \/>\n<strong>9 hurricanes<\/strong>,<br \/>\n<strong>4 major hurricanes<\/strong>.<\/p>\n<p>This outlook surpasses the <strong>historical average<\/strong>, which stands at <strong>14 named storms<\/strong>, <strong>7 hurricanes<\/strong>, and <strong>3 major hurricanes<\/strong> per season.<\/p>\n<p>&nbsp;<\/p>\n<p><strong>Landfall probabilities along U.S. coastlines<\/strong><\/p>\n<p>The probability of a <strong>major hurricane<\/strong> (Category 3, 4, or 5) striking the <strong>U.S. coastline<\/strong> in 2025 has also increased. According to <strong>CSU&#8217;s predictions<\/strong>:<\/p>\n<p>There is a <strong>51% chance<\/strong> a major hurricane could hit <strong>anywhere along the U.S. coast<\/strong>,<br \/>\nA <strong>26% chance<\/strong> for the <strong>East Coast<\/strong>, including <strong>Florida<\/strong>,<br \/>\nA <strong>33% chance<\/strong> for the <strong>Gulf Coast<\/strong>,<br \/>\nAnd a <strong>56% chance<\/strong> for the <strong>Caribbean islands<\/strong>.<\/p>\n<p>These numbers reflect a <strong>notable rise<\/strong> over the <strong>1880\u20132020 average<\/strong>, underscoring the importance of <strong>vigilance and early monitoring<\/strong>.<\/p>\n<p>&nbsp;<\/p>\n<p><strong>2025 storm names released<\/strong><\/p>\n<p>The <strong>official list of storm names<\/strong> for the <strong>Atlantic 2025 season<\/strong> includes:<br \/>\n<strong>Andrea, Barry, Chantal, Dexter, Erin, Fernand, Gabrielle, Humberto, Imelda, Jerry, Karen, Lorenzo, Melissa, Nestor, Olga, Pablo, Rebekah, Sebastien, Tanya, Van, Wendy<\/strong>.<\/p>\n<p><strong>Ocean heat content and African Monsoon may intensify season<\/strong><\/p>\n<p>Several <strong>climatic signals<\/strong> are contributing to the elevated forecast. The <strong>transition to a neutral ENSO pattern<\/strong> tends to <strong>suppress wind shear<\/strong>, creating a <strong>more conducive environment<\/strong> for storm formation and intensification. Combined with <strong>above-normal sea surface temperatures<\/strong> and a <strong>more active West African Monsoon<\/strong>, these factors may help spawn <strong>more frequent and stronger tropical systems<\/strong> across the <strong>Atlantic<\/strong>.<\/p>\n<p>&nbsp;<\/p>\n<p><strong>Localized weather impacts expected despite low development<\/strong><\/p>\n<p>Even if this <strong>current system<\/strong> does <strong>not develop further<\/strong>, its <strong>meteorological influence<\/strong> will still be <strong>felt along Florida\u2019s east coast<\/strong> through <strong>increased winds, surf, and thunderstorm activity<\/strong>.
